“Homeless” is a psychological horror game where you play as a man named Albert, a night shift security guard at a Brooklyn subway station. While checking the security cameras, Albert notices a strange figure lurking in the restricted railway are a skinny man in dirty clothes, oddly Tall!
Initially, Albert thinks he’s dealing with a harmless and vulnerable homeless person, as usual. But as he uncovers the person’s crimes, he realizes he’s in for a night of madness. Homeless is a dark psychological horror game set in the gritty neighborhoods of 1990s New York City. The game utilizes the Unreal Engine 5 to create a realistic and immersive atmosphere, capturing the essence of a terrifying night.
The gameplay emphasizes the player’s sense of responsibility as a security guard. The level design is intended to make the player feel like a real security guard. You’ll need to check CCTV, patrol the area, and investigate suspicious activity like a real security guard.
This game focuses on a simple but stressful story rather than complex and and tedious mechanics.
Gameplay mechanics include exploration, crime scene investigation, puzzle-solving, and, in some instances, gunplay.
